#141038 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#141038 is composed of 7.8% red, 6.3%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.3% cyan, 71.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 78% black. It has a hue angle of 246 degrees, a saturation of 55.6% and a lightness of 14.1%. #141038 color hex could be obtained by blending #282070 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

Shades and Tints of #141038
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04030a is the darkest color, while #fafafe is the lightest one.

Tones of #141038
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#242325 is the less saturated color, while #090246 is the most saturated one.
